Yates Johnson
Yates Johnson is an American professional pickleball player renowned for his dynamic playstyle and remarkable transition from tennis to pickleball. Born on June 2, 1994, in Taos, New Mexico, he currently resides in New Braunfels, Texas. Standing 6’2″ tall, Johnson plays right-handed and turned professional in 2022.
Early Life
Growing up in Arizona, Yates and his twin brother, Hunter Johnson, developed a passion for tennis. They achieved significant success in high school, becoming three-time state doubles champions. Their prowess continued at Southern Methodist University (SMU) in Dallas, Texas, where they became the most successful doubles team in the school’s history, achieving a career-high national doubles ranking of No. 15.
Family Life
Yates shares a close bond with his twin brother, Hunter Johnson, who is also a professional pickleball player. The duo’s synergy on the court has been evident throughout their careers, from their tennis days to their current pickleball endeavors.
Career
After college, Yates and Hunter transitioned to professional tennis, competing on the ATP Tour for four years. During this period, they secured 14 professional titles, including 13 ITF Futures and one ATP Challenger title, and achieved a top-200 doubles ranking. In late 2021, following a five-month injury hiatus, Yates made the decision to retire from tennis and pursue a full-time career in professional pickleball. This move was groundbreaking, as they were among the first active professional tennis players to switch to pickleball.
Since joining the Professional Pickleball Association (PPA) Tour in 2024, Yates has quickly made a name for himself. He achieved a notable victory over third-seeded Tyson McGuffin in his PPA debut at the North Carolina Open. As of June 2025, he holds the following rankings:
Men’s Singles: No. 22
Men’s Doubles: No. 56
Mixed Doubles: No. 52
In addition to his PPA achievements, Yates competes in Major League Pickleball (MLP) as a member of the Utah Black Diamonds.
